Cattle fence repair services involve restoring and maintaining fencing systems designed to contain livestock, primarily cattle, on rural or agricultural properties. These services typically include fixing broken or damaged fence posts, replacing worn-out wire or mesh, and reinforcing sections that have become weak or unstable. Skilled contractors assess the condition of existing fencing, identify areas that need attention, and perform repairs that help ensure the fence functions effectively in keeping cattle safely contained and preventing them from wandering onto neighboring properties or roads.

Many common problems prompt cattle owners to seek fence repair services. Over time, fences can suffer from weather-related wear, such as rusted wire, rotting posts, or sagging sections. Animals may also cause damage by leaning or pushing against the fence, leading to broken or loose wires. Additionally, ground shifting or erosion can undermine the stability of fence posts, creating gaps or weak spots. Repairing these issues helps maintain the integrity of the fencing, reducing the risk of livestock escapes and minimizing the need for more extensive replacements in the future.

These services are often used on a variety of properties, including farms, ranches, and large rural estates where cattle are raised. Even smaller homesteads with livestock may require occasional fence repairs to keep animals safe and secure. Properties that experience frequent weather fluctuations or have older fencing systems are more likely to need regular maintenance and repairs. By addressing fencing issues promptly, property owners can avoid larger problems down the line, such as animal injuries or property damage caused by livestock escaping.

The overview below groups typical Cattle Fence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or fence repairs, such as replacing a few broken posts or sections, generally range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the extent of damage and materials needed.

Moderate Repairs - For more extensive fixes like replacing multiple panels or repairing damaged wiring, local contractors often charge between $600 and $1,500. These projects are common and tend to stay within this mid-tier cost range.

Full Fence Replacement - Replacing an entire fence or a large section can cost from $2,000 to $5,000 or more, especially for high-quality materials or complex layouts. Larger, more involved projects are less frequent but can reach into this higher cost bracket.

Custom or Complex Projects - Highly customized or complex fencing projects, such as integrating electric fencing or working around challenging terrain, can exceed $5,000. These are typically less common and involve additional planning and materials.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of cattle fence repairs do local contractors handle? Local service providers can repair various types of fences, including wire, wooden, and electric fences, to restore their functionality and durability.

How can I tell if my cattle fence needs repair? Signs such as broken or sagging sections, loose wires, or animals escaping can indicate the need for fence repairs by local contractors.

Are there common issues that cause cattle fences to fail? Common problems include wire breakage, wooden post rot, and damage from weather or animals, which local pros are experienced in addressing.

What maintenance tasks are involved in cattle fence repair? Maintenance may involve replacing damaged posts, tightening wires, and sealing wooden components to ensure the fence remains secure.

How do local contractors ensure the durability of cattle fence repairs? They typically use appropriate materials and techniques suited to the fence type and local conditions to enhance longevity.
